描述
c 庫函式char *strcpy(char *dest, const char *src)把src所指向的字串複製到dest。
宣告
下面是 strcpy() 函式的宣告。
char *strcpy(char *dest, const char *src)引數
返回值
該函式返回乙個指向最終的目標字串 dest 的指標。
例項
下面的例項演示了 strcpy() 函式的用法。
#include #include int main()
讓我們編譯並執行上面的程式,這將產生以下結果:
最終的目標字串: this is runoob.com描述
c 庫函式char *strcat(char *dest, const char *src)把src所指向的字串追加到dest所指向的字串的結尾。
宣告
下面是 strcat() 函式的宣告。
char *strcat(char *dest, const char *src)引數
返回值
該函式返回乙個指向最終的目標字串 dest 的指標。
例項
下面的例項演示了 strcat() 函式的用法。
#include #include int main ()
讓我們編譯並執行上面的程式,這將產生以下結果:
最終的目標字串: |this is destinationthis is source|
實現C庫函式strcpy
原型宣告 char strcpy char dst,const char src strcpy 實現沒有檢查dst和src記憶體重疊問題 char strcpy char dst,const char src const約束,內容不可變 return pstr 返回dst,允許鏈式表示式 檢查記憶體...
C語言 模擬實現strcpy函式與strcat函式
strcpy函式 首先我們來了解一下strcpy函式的功能和用法 strcpy是一種c語言的標準庫函式,strcpy把從src位址開始且含有 0 結束符的字串複製到以dest開始的位址空間,返回值的型別為char 也就是將乙個字串拷貝到另乙個字串中。那接下來我們看如何具體實現。我們的基本思想是定義兩...
C語言strcpy庫函式詳解
目錄 1.從上面的msdn關於strcpy庫函式的簡介中,我們可以知道,傳進函式的第乙個引數是目標陣列,也就是用來接收被拷貝的字串,第二個引數是源頭陣列,也就是將這個引數的字串拷貝www.cppcns.com到目標陣列裡面去。一定要注意目標陣列的空間大小一定要比源頭陣列的空間大小大,不然即使拷貝成功...